Output 15e5ecda23aef13b13c25dab4ce452ca5925668666b83628f85d1bf88d7313b6:0

value
339507840
script pubkey
OP_0 OP_PUSHBYTES_20 81dbeb6fc588114fb216d452d89094b42613c7a2
address
bc1qs8d7km793qg5lvsk63fd3yy5ksnp83az85phwr
transaction
15e5ecda23aef13b13c25dab4ce452ca5925668666b83628f85d1bf88d7313b6